Hello George, Tuesday, September 9, 2025, 6:22:27 PM, you wrote: > Can I ask creators to forget that ugly appdata and other folders and do as early — installation inside Program Files? As hideous as I find this style (backing up all those X versions of Chrome comprising gigabytes and other binaries along with the profile) - the reason is almost certainly that installing into the user profile avoids the necessity to invoke the UAC (have or get the Admin rights in order to write into program files) for installing or updating the program. And it only applies to the "Automatic Updates" flavor of the package.
